Protests under the banner 'No Kings' have taken place across the United States, focusing on opposition to President Trump's administration.
Context
These protests represent a continuation of organized resistance against President Trump's policies since his second term began.S1S2
Key points
- The 'No Kings' protests are the third round of demonstrations since President Trump's second term began.S1
- Protesters are rallying against President Trump's policies and governance.S2
- The events are part of a global movement against Trump, with significant participation in the U.S.S2
- More than 3,000 demonstrations have been planned across the country.S2
- The protests have a strong focus in Minnesota, among other locations.S1
- Participants are using the protests to express their discontent with the current administration.S1
- The movement has gained traction since Trump's inauguration for a second term.S1
